Scape is built for the desk where four terminals each run a different agent and the human is the bottleneck for approvals. The macOS app runs unlimited sessions, each isolated in its own git worktree, and layers a code inspector, watchdogs that auto-field routine questions, and voice transcription on top. Argus supervises: it takes an objective, spawns child agents, auto-approves routine decisions, and escalates the rest, while Playbooks encode repeatable multi-step processes that agents execute and report into owned tables. Agent-to-agent chat and networked rendezvous let a Claude session debate a Codex one, including across teammates' machines over encrypted channels. It requires the user's existing agent subscriptions, ships as a beta macOS app from Scape Labs with a public releases repo, and targets developers running several agents daily.
